Hackety Hack!: Hackety Hack is a free application that teaches basic programming and coding concepts to kids and beginners. It uses Ruby to allow users to learn coding in a simple, interactive environment with fun graphics and sounds.

Scrivener: Scrivener is professional writing software used by authors to plan, organize and write long documents like novels and screenplays. It has features like corkboard, outliner, annotations, and split screen to help write drafts and revisions.

Scrivener Features
  • Corkboard view to visualize story structure
  • Outliner to organize scenes and chapters
  • Annotations and comments to provide feedback on drafts
  • Split screen to view multiple documents
  • Templates for common formats like novels and screenplays
  • Revision tracking to compare draft changes
  • Export to common formats like PDF and ePub
